1. Agreed on Snow... but thats his character, and he does grow from it. I wouldn't say he is any worse than Tidus or Irvine personally.

2. Hope has every reason to hate Snow, he blames him for his mother's death. Of course its not Snow's fault, but Hope is a kid, and it makes perfect sense to hate Snow from his perspective imo. You see a grown man tell your mom to go run into a battle, and she gets killed and he lives... and you are just a kid. Seems like plenty of reason to me.

3. Vanille has a lot more to do with the story than that, but like Sazh and Fang, you don't really learn anything about them until later in the game. She ends up being a lot more than Hope's support, and is as integral to the story as.... well, as each character.

I know I've said it before, but I really like XIII's cast. Its not their individual characters that drew me in, but how they are all actually involved in the story. Every character grows and changes, and has a reason to be on the journey. I'd much prefer Snow going back and forth with emotional problems than Quina fighting along our side because.... it wants to eat. Or Vaan just mixing himself into Ashe's business just because his brother was important, and then dragging Penello along because... I don't even remember.
